I've mowed for a PGA course. Keep your eyes up and trust a distant point in the horizon. Don't look down! Also, for super precise stripes, leave a 1/2 inch "holiday" and get it on the double cut. It will add dark border to each stripe. Make wide turns, and mow the same exact stripes every other day for a couple weeks.

Smooth tires I am a equipment manager at a golf course and i run smooth tires on all my triplexes. Less destruction to the turf and grass recovers quicker. Wide turns also helps. And I would put smooth rollers on the front. Will flatten out the grass more( more stripe). You cut your yard at what I cut tees and fairways at. We range from .500 to .700. Or as low as .400. The mower weight itself is alot.i do believe smooth tires would really help you.

Used to mow here. Never used a mower like this, what I do to keep a straight line is look at an object or area at the end of your line. Drive directly towards where you are focusing. Do not worry about the wheel at all your body will automatically do it for you. You will have an extremely straight line. Once you have your first line. You just look directly at the end of the edge of your line. never look down to see how close your deck is to the line, this will ruin your line trust me. Always stay looking straight down line. Look where you want your mower to be. :) keep your arms loose and your brain will handle the lay of the land. you will probably being doing little constant lefts and rights.

I've spent too much time on a sidewinder. Couple things try shifting reels to left or right when going around stuff. So you're not doing same passes around stuff. Other thing is we run smooth back tire. Helps some with tire marks when turning and never turn the wheel when not moving. You probably could even run smooth tires on the front wheels also. We don't because we do banks with our sidewinder.
